Report: Tottenham star offered huge deal to play in Saudi Arabia

The latest reports suggest that Tottenham Hotspur goalkeeper Hugo Lloris has been offered a huge contract in Saudi Arabia.

According to The Times, should Lloris want to play in Saudi Arabia next season, he now has a contract on the table that will be worth three times his current salary.

The goalkeeper, who has also captained Spurs, is currently on £100k-a-week. Therefore this new deal will see him be paid £400k-a-week should he accept.

His contract expires next year and he is understood to be open to a new challenge. The World Cup winner has been at Spurs for sometime but has received some criticism when he has played this season.

Hugo Lloris offered new contract that would treble his salary

Saudi Arabia are trying to recruit various huge footballers to join their domestic football league. We have already seen Cristiano Ronaldo head there.

What they have over clubs across Europe is huge wealth. They are able to offer huge contracts in which the players can get huge salaries.

Many have praised the star, including Ryan Mason who called Lloris “one of the best in the world“. It is no shock to see him the latest linked to Saudi Arabia.

The “magnificent” goalkeeper will no doubt go down in history as a Spurs legend. It would no be a shock to see him accept this huge deal.

With Lloris now 36 years-old, the deal could benefit both parties. He can finish his career on a healthy salary and Spurs can free up some wages to bring in a younger goalkeeper.
